Employment Disability Resources Second Annual Mentoring Day

Employment Disability Resources announces its second annual Mentoring Day, taking place on Wednesday, August 21 with DakotAbilities. Mentoring Day pairs local businesses with people with disabilities who have expressed interest in learning new skills and possible job opportunities available for a morning of job shadowing.
